Sash windows are more than simply functional openings; they are architectural icons that define the character of Georgian, Victorian, and Edwardian homes. Known for their stylish percentages and vertical sliding system, these windows have stood the test of time for centuries. However, timber is a natural product subject to the impulses of the components. Over decades, sash windows can become drafty, rattled, or seized by layers of old paint.

For lots of homeowners, the problem emerges: should these historical features be changed with modern-day options, or is repair the better course? This guide checks out the intricate process of sash window repair, the advantages of repair, and the technical factors to consider associated with bringing these timeless features into the 21st century.

Typical Problems with Heritage Sash Windows

Understanding the specific issues that afflict older windows is the first step toward an effective repair. The majority of sash window problems fall into one of five classifications:

  1. Rot and Decay: Usually found in the bottom rail or the sill, where water collects.
  2. Structural Instability: Loose joints brought on by years of movement or seasonal expansion.
  3. Operation Failure: Broken sash cords, seized sheaves, or windows painted shut.
  4. Poor Thermal Performance: Significant gaps between the sash and the frame leading to heat loss.
  5. Aesthetic Degradation: Flaking paint, cracked putty, or "crowned" glass that has slipped.

1. Evaluation and Dismantling

The procedure starts by carefully getting rid of the staff beads and parting beads-- the wood strips that hold the sashes in place. The sashes are then unhooked from their cables, and the weights are removed from the "pocket" inside the frame.

2. Paint Removal and Timber Repair

Old paint layers, which frequently include lead, are carefully stripped back to expose the bare wood. Any areas of rot are identified. Small rot can be treated with specialized liquid wood hardeners and epoxy resins. Nevertheless, if the decay is comprehensive, a "splice repair work" is performed. This involves cutting out the diseased area and jointing in a brand-new piece of experienced timber (normally Accoya or similar durable wood) to match the original profile.

3. Glass and Putty Restoration

If the initial cylinder or crown glass is intact, it is protected. If the glass is broken, it can be changed with matching heritage glass or "Slimlite" double-glazed units if the sash depth enables. Old, fragile putty is hacked out and changed with fresh linseed oil putty or modern polymer equivalents.

4. Draught-Proofing Integration

This is possibly the most vital stage of a modern refurbishment. To eliminate rattles and drafts, "brush strips" or pile providers are quietly machined into the meeting rails and beads. This produces a covert seal that prevents air leakage while allowing the window to slide efficiently.

5. Re-balancing and Re-hanging

When the sashes are fixed and painted, they need to be re-installed. New, high-quality waxed cotton cables are fitted. Because repair work or new glass can change the weight of the sash, the lead or iron weights inside the frames are changed (often by adding little lead "make-weights") to ensure the window remains perfectly balanced and stays open at any height.

The Benefits of Professional Refurbishment

Bring back sash windows offers a blend of historical conservation and modern performance enhancements.

  • Thermal Efficiency: A reconditioned window with incorporated draught-proofing can decrease heat loss through the window by up to 80%, considerably reducing energy costs.
  • Noise Reduction: The installation of seals and much heavier glass can noticeably dampen external noise from traffic or pedestrians.
  • Smooth Operation: Gone are the days of struggling with a window that refuses to budge. A refurbished window can often be moved with the touch of a single finger.
  • Increased Property Value: Original features are a major selling point for duration homes. Purchasers typically choose restored original windows over uPVC replacements.

Upkeep Tips for Longevity

Once a window has been reconditioned, a basic upkeep regimen will guarantee it lasts for another numerous years.

  • Yearly Cleaning: Clean the glass and the wood frames with a soft fabric and moderate detergent.
  • Paint Inspections: Check for any fractures or chips in the paint every spring. Retouching little areas instantly prevents wetness from reaching the timber.
  • Sheave Lubrication: A little drop of light machine oil on the pulley wheels when a year keeps the system silent.
  • Ventilation: Use the windows frequently. Sash windows are designed to assist in outstanding airflow, with cool air going into at the bottom and warm air getting away at the top.

Can I set up double glazing into my initial sash windows?

In a lot of cases, yes. If the lumber is in good condition and the sash is deep enough, "slim-line" double-glazed systems (often 12mm to 14mm thick) can be retrofitted into the existing frames. This supplies the thermal benefits of modern windows without altering the appearance of the residential or commercial property.

Is the refurbishment procedure messy?

It can be, especially during the sanding and paint-stripping phases. Expert contractors normally use dust extraction systems and durable floor security to reduce the influence on the home's interior.

How long does it take to recondition a single window?

Depending on the level of repair needed, a single window usually takes in between one and 2 days of labor, spread out across several stages (stripping, fixing, painting, and re-fitting).

Do I need preparing approval for repair?

Typically, no. Since repair is considered "repair and maintenance," it does not typically require planning approval. However, if you reside in a Grade I or Grade II listed structure and plan to change the glass type (e.g., to double glazing), you must consult your local Heritage Officer initially.

Why not just utilize uPVC sash windows?

While contemporary uPVC sashes are much better than they utilized to be, they still lack the thin sightlines of wood. In addition, uPVC is a "non reusable" material-- once it breaks or the seals fail, the entire unit typically needs to be replaced. Timber is considerably repairable.
